    Quote Originally Posted by The Night King View Post
    I know there are some sales going on with animal plastics but I really like being able to reach in from the top - reaching in from the front in a small tank he always seems really defensive and coiled whereas from the top I can scoop him out pretty easily and I know with those PVC enclosures you can only go in from the front just not sure how I feel about that Since we like to handle him 2 to 3X a week...
    You may like reaching in from the top but trust me as someone who had glass for years, the difference in having conditions just right and stressing about keeping them right make a PVC enclosure worth it. With time and training you can easily get your snake to be comfortable with any direction you come in to handle them.

    So ask yourself this: Is it more important for you to have an easy time to scoop my snake out or is it better for your snake to have perfect conditions?
